Online Casinos Continue to Put Pressure on Brick and Mortar Casinos

Online casinos offer more value than brick-and-mortar casinos for gamblers. Online casinos don’t have the overhead associated with a Las Vegas casino or Atlantic City casino so they can provide better odds and more significant bonuses. Traditional land-based casinos are popular because of their fancy hotels and fine restaurants. Atlantic City legalized gambling in 1976. Las Vegas casinos realized they needed to do more than offer gambling. This was the start of the Las Vegas Mega-Resort. To be a popular vacation spot, the Mega-Resort offers a wide range of services for all ages. The land needed to build a resort in Las Vegas costs approximately $5 billion.

Foxwoods was established in 1986 as a bingo hall located on Indian land. Foxwoods also added casino tables in 1992 and slot machines to its premises in 1993. Atlantic City was in the same place as Las Vegas. They had to offer more than gambling. Atlantic City responded to the problem similarly to Las Vegas: they spent money on it. The Foxwoods casino attracted millions of tourists and continued to grow through the 1990s and early 2000s until the economic downturn caused states to relax their laws on casino gambling. Today, Foxwoods is the biggest casino in the world. However, smaller casinos are taking their business. To attract top-line entertainment, they have opened the MGM Foxwoods.
